Let's explain ...The Value of HSA Accounts Has Improved recently.HSAs could possibly consistently be actually used to purchase qualified clinical costs like physicians sees, flu shots, prescribed drugs, surgical operation, prescribed glasses and contacts, and a lot more. Along with latest laws, the value of having an HSA profile has actually increased. It is currently feasible to utilize HSA, FSA, and HRA funds for OTC medicines and also menstruation treatment items. The capability to make use of these represent non-prescribed OTC items was actually earlier removed in 2011.And, recently, the internal revenue service delivered advice that HSA-eligible HDHPs must look at a lot of popular medical solutions, medicines, and gadgets, including insulin, inhalers, and also statins as "preventative treatment". For programs that adopt that guidance, these things may be fully covered due to the insurance provider prior to the deductible.HSA Funds Possess Extreme Market Value for Saving Ideas.HSAs may possess fantastic market value for big saving ideas who are actually privileged enough to have one. HSAs feel like IRAs on anabolic steroids (tax-free steroids at that). They provide users pre-tax additions, tax-free expenditure gains, as well as tax-free distributions to spend for qualified clinical costs.With HSAs, you own the account. It picks you as well as could be utilized regardless of future job standing or even health insurance plan. This is actually certainly not the situation with FSAs, which are linked to your company. And, unfortunately, you can certainly not roll over FSA funds to an HSA.All advantages apart, your ability to each year result in an HSA is figured out by whether you are enlisted in a high tax deductible health insurance (HDHP), as they are defined due to the IRS.For 2024, HDHPs are actually Defined as:.A minimum yearly tax deductible: of a minimum of $1,600 for individual protection or even $3,200 for family members protection and.Yearly out-of-pocket cost maxes: (e.g., deductibles, co-payments, and various other quantities, but not fees) approximately $8,050 for individual coverage or even $16,100 for household protection.For 2025, HDHPs are actually Specified as:.A minimal annual insurance deductible: of at least $1,650 for private coverage or $3,300 for loved ones coverage as well as.Annual out-of-pocket cost optimums: (e.g., deductibles, co-payments, and other quantities, but not premiums) up to $8,300 for individual protection or even $16,600 for family members protection.Take this in to point to consider when open application happens this loss.Now, on the interesting component-- the HSA optimum payment quantities for 2024 as well as 2025.2024 Max HSA Contribution Limits.The max HSA contribution volumes for 2024 are actually:.Private Program: $4,150 (+$ 300 over prior year).Household Strategy: $8,300 (+$ 550 over previous year).Take note: The max HSA contribution features both company + employee payments.2025 Optimum HSA Payment Limitations.The maximum HSA contribution amounts for 2025 are:.Personal Plan: $4,300 (+$ 150 over previous year).Family Planning: $8,550 (+$ 250 over previous year).Note: The maximum HSA addition consists of both company + employee payments.2024 &amp 2025 HSA Catch-Up Addition Volume.Identical to Individual Retirement Accounts and 401Ks, there are actually mesmerize contributions for those grow older 55 as well as over. The HSA catch-up payment is $1,000 every qualified person (+$ 1,000 for an individual strategy and also +$ 2,000 for a family members program) for 2024 as well as 2025.Can you Result In an HSA Outside of a Company Pay-roll Deduction?Yes, you can easily add to an HSA outside of a company. As well as the very same tax obligation deductible advantages apply (you simply will not manage to entirely discover all of them till you do your income taxes for the year.When is the HSA Payment Target Date?The HSA addition target date is the same time as the tax deadline. This suggests you have extra opportunity after completion of the fiscal year to retroactively make HSA payments for that year, up till the tax obligation deadline.The Situation for Maxing Out your HSA Payment.Here's why you need to think about adding as long as you may to an HSA: if you are youthful as well as healthy, medical expenses will ultimately catch up with you. HSAs allow you to build a considerable pillow to secure your own self from future expenses, while providing you phenomenal income tax advantages on contributions and also withdrawals. Why purchase health care expenses with after-tax bucks if you could pay with pre-tax dollars?When you switch 65, you can easily utilize HSA funds on not merely clinical expenditures, but anything, scot-free (non-medical expenses are taxed like Typical IRA circulations)-- therefore there's little bit of negative aspect to providing excessive. As well as, keep in mind that the whole entire time you may increase your contributions with expenditures, just like every other pension.For the most part, you'll need to determine your HSA contributions for the subsequent year during your open enrollment. Your employer is going to often permit you contribute a specified amount equally all over all salary time periods. Some employers will certainly permit you to help make much larger payments in the direction of completion of the year, and also some may also permit you to front-load your HSA contributions at the beginning of the year. Your employer might additionally produce their own tax-free payments to your HSA, if you are enrolled in their HDHP offering.How to Open Up a New HSA to Aid Optimize your HSA Additions.Opening up a brand-new HSA or transferring funds from an existing HSA to another HSA is easy to do.
